1890. A Turkish warship sinks off a poor fishing village in Japan. πΉπ·
The villagers swim out in a typhoon. They pull 69 men out of the water. More than 500 are already gone.
The village has almost no food. They give the survivors their own emergency rice. Their last chickens. Their clothes.
Then they send them home.
95 years pass.
1985. Iran-Iraq war. Iraq announces it will shoot down any plane over Iran in 48 hours. 215 Japanese are trapped in Tehran. Japan sends nobody.
Turkey sends two planes.
Turkish citizens at that airport gave up their own seats and drove out of Iran by road. π―π΅πΉπ·
They said their grandfathers told them about the village. π
